RJD MLAs Demand 85% Reservation, Disrupt Bihar Assembly Proceedings

Opposition legislators cite the 2023 caste survey, seeking Ninth Schedule protection to overcome the Supreme Court’s 50% cap.

Overview

  • Lawmaker protests began with a sit-in at the Assembly entrance before members rushed into the Well with placards, leading the Speaker to adjourn the House.
  • The demand seeks 85% quotas in government jobs and admissions, framed as proportional to population shares shown in the caste survey.
  • Protesters urged the state to pursue inclusion of an expanded quota law in the Ninth Schedule to shield it from court challenges.
  • The Assembly had unanimously cleared a 65% reservation increase in 2023, which the Patna High Court later struck down for breaching the 50% ceiling and reaching 75% with the 10% EWS quota.
  • LJP(RV) legislators separately demanded an apology from the RJD over remarks about the late Ram Vilas Paswan, while the RJD has said it moved the Supreme Court against the High Court order.
